How to Find, Clear Google Voice Searches

Googling...


Managing your searches.

Google likes to keep all of your voice searches on its servers so it can more easily learn to recognize your voice, understand what you might be looking for in the future, and, of course, serve you ads, David Nield reports on gizmodo.com.

If you want to review this archive of Google Now searches and clear it out, here’s what to do, he wrote.

If you haven’t visited your Google Account page in a while, you might be surprised at just how clean and comprehensive it’s become. From www.google.com/account it’s possible to view just about everything Google has on you, add extra security features to your account, personalize your Google experience and more besides, Nield added.
